Charlton seal play-off spot with win over Northampton

Matty Godden’s 18th goal of the season helped Charlton secure their place in the League One play-offs with a 2-1 win over Northampton.

Luke Berry put the Addicks ahead in the ninth minute. The attacking midfielder struck a right-footed volley home after Northampton defender TJ Eyoma could only partially cut out Godden’s cross.

Dara Costelloe equalised for the visitors soon after. The striker sent goalkeeper Will Mannion the wrong way from the penalty spot after referee Ollie Yates penalised Tom McIntyre for handling Tariqe Fosu’s teasing delivery.

Former Charlton winger Fosu produced a terrible miss in the 53rd minute from close range after being picked out by Tyler Roberts – his attempt harmlessly drifting out towards the left touchline.

Godden rattled the crossbar in the 67th minute from Thierry Small’s cross but the veteran striker made no mistake four minutes later, sliding his finish underneath Northampton goalkeeper Lee Burge after racing on to Chuks Aneke’s flick-on.

Northampton substitute James Wilson was just unable to reach Costelloe’s pass as Charlton endured a nervy finish but moved up to fourth in the table.
